Product Overview

DIN 17175 is the German standard for seamless heat-resistant steel tubes intended for boilers, superheaters, heat exchangers, and high temperature pressure systems. These tubes offer excellent creep strength and oxidation resistance for elevated temperature service up to 600°C .

Key Characteristics:

Heat-Resistant Definition:
Steels that maintain good mechanical properties under long-term stress at high temperatures up to 600°C .

Steel Grades Covered:

  • St35.8 – Carbon steel for general boiler service (EN 10216-2: P235GH)

  • St45.8 – Carbon steel for higher strength boiler service (EN 10216-2: P265GH)

  • 15Mo3 – Molybdenum alloy steel for medium temperature service (EN 10216-2: 16Mo3)

  • 13CrMo44 – 1% Chrome-0.5% Molybdenum for high temperature service (EN 10216-2: 13CrMo4-5)

  • 10CrMo910 – 2.25% Chrome-1% Molybdenum for advanced high temperature (EN 10216-2: 10CrMo9-10)

⚠️ Important Note: DIN 17175 has been withdrawn and replaced by EN 10216-2 . However, we continue to supply material to DIN 17175 specifications for legacy replacement, maintenance, and retrofit projects where the old standard is still specified .

📌 Heat treatment: Tubes shall be appropriately heat treated over their entire length. Depending on steel type, treatments include normalizing, subcritical annealing, quenching and tempering, or isothermal transformation hardening and tempering .

Steel Grade Cross-Reference

DIN 17175 Grade EN 10216-2 Equivalent ASTM Equivalent GB Equivalent Type
St35.8 P235GH A106 Grade B 20G Carbon steel
St45.8 P265GH A106 Grade C 25MnG Carbon steel (higher strength)
15Mo3 16Mo3 A209 T1 15MoG Molybdenum alloy
13CrMo44 13CrMo4-5 A213 T12 15CrMoG 1% Chrome-0.5% Molybdenum
10CrMo910 10CrMo9-10 A213 T22 10CrMo910 2.25% Chrome-1% Molybdenum

💡 For new projects, we recommend specifying EN 10216-2 equivalents .

Grade Selection Guide – Temperature & Application

Grade Type Max Temp (°C) Typical Application
St35.8 Carbon steel 400-450 General boiler service, economizers
St45.8 Carbon steel (high strength) 400-450 Higher strength boiler tubes
15Mo3 Molybdenum alloy 450-500 Medium temperature service
13CrMo44 1% Chrome-0.5% Molybdenum 500-550 High temperature service – most popular
10CrMo910 2.25% Chrome-1% Molybdenum 550-600 Advanced high temperature service

Chemical Composition – DIN 17175 Grades

Grade C Si Mn P max S max Cr Mo
St35.8 ≤0.17 0.10-0.35 0.40-0.80 0.030 0.030
St45.8 ≤0.21 0.10-0.35 0.40-1.20 0.030 0.030
15Mo3 0.12-0.20 0.10-0.35 0.40-0.80 0.030 0.030 0.25-0.35
13CrMo44 0.10-0.18 0.10-0.35 0.40-0.70 0.030 0.030 0.70-1.10 0.45-0.65
10CrMo910 0.08-0.15 ≤0.50 0.40-0.70 0.030 0.030 2.00-2.50 0.90-1.20

Mechanical Properties – DIN 17175 Grades

Grade Tensile Strength (MPa) Yield Strength (MPa) Elongation (%)
St35.8 360 – 480 ≥235 ≥25
St45.8 410 – 530 ≥255 ≥21
15Mo3 450 – 600 ≥270 ≥20
13CrMo44 440 – 590 ≥290 ≥20
10CrMo910 450 – 600 ≥280 ≥18

Elevated Temperature Capability

Grade Recommended Max Temp Creep Resistance Limitation
St35.8 / St45.8 Up to 450°C Limited
15Mo3 Up to 510°C Good (Mo addition) Graphitization tendency >510°C
13CrMo44 Up to 550°C Excellent (Cr-Mo)
10CrMo910 Up to 600°C Superior (higher Cr-Mo)

⚠️ 15Mo3 Limitation: This steel tends toward graphitization during long-term operation at high temperatures. Therefore, its operating temperature should be controlled below 510°C .

FAQ – DIN 17175 Tubes

Q1: Is DIN 17175 still active?
A: No – DIN 17175 has been withdrawn and replaced by EN 10216-2 . We supply to this standard for legacy replacement projects.

Q2: What is the equivalent of St35.8 in EN 10216-2?
A: P235GH – the direct replacement grade with equivalent properties.

Q3: What is the equivalent of 13CrMo44 in EN 10216-2?
A: 13CrMo4-5 – the current European standard grade.

Q4: What is the maximum operating temperature for 15Mo3?
A: 510°C (950°F) . Above this temperature, the steel has a tendency toward graphitization.

Q5: What is the most popular grade for high temperature boilers?
A: 13CrMo44 – 1% Chrome-0.5% Molybdenum, suitable for service up to 550°C.
